1) Dolmen Resort, St. Paul’s Bay, Malta
Dolmen Resort is ideally located on the water’s edge of St. Paul’s Bay, in the popular tourist town of Qawra. This extensive four star hotel boasts a total of 375 bedrooms and 38 suites, all featuring panoramic views of the Mediterranean and St. Paul’s Islands. There are a number of activities available to keep the whole family entertained, including four outdoor swimming pools, two tennis courts, and a beach club complete with a diving centre and variety of water sports. The newly designed Spa offers state-of-the-art treatments, in addition to an indoor pool, fitness centre, sauna and hydro-massage. Evening entertainment includes two restaurants, a casino, a piano cocktail bar and a wine bar.

2) Iberostar Chich Khan, Hammamet, Tunisia
This sunny corner of Africa promises warmer temperatures this Easter. Hammamet was Tunisia’s first tourist destination and is popular for its beaches and water sports. Iberostar Chich Khan makes the most of these claims to fame by offering guests a private beach. The hotel also boasts a total of three swimming pools, with one covered and heated for the colder months. Chich Khan is decorated and furnished in authentic Berber and Moorish styles and offers a traditional ‘Hammam’ Turkish bath. The hotel has a total of 252 guest rooms and a variety of restaurants and bars, including a brewery and a tea parlour. The nightlife of Hammamet is right on the hotel’s doorstep.

4) Shems Moon, Marrakech, Morocco
Shemms Moon is a tranquil retreat located just 25 minutes from the eclectic city of Marrakech, in the foothills of the picturesque Atlas Mountains. The hotel features a 200 squared metre swimming pool, landscaped gardens and quiet terraces overlooking the surrounding sand dunes. There is a traditional hammam and various personalised Spa treatments available for a relaxing Easter break. The hotel also offers a restaurant specialising in traditional Moroccan cuisine, a cosy lounge and bar, a libary and free Wi-Fi. Cooking workshops, jet skiing at Lalla Takerkoust Dam, donkey riding and hiking can all be organised through Shems Moon. Shopping enthusiasts should head to Marrakech to lose themselves in the famous markets.

8) Marriott Hurghada Beach Resort, Hurghada, Egypt
Why not visit the Red Sea this Easter? The inlet between Africa and Asia is the world’s northernmost tropical sea and home to an impressive array of marine life. Hurghada is a popular tourist destination from which to discover this exciting area, renowned for its water sports, snorkelling and scuba diving. The Hurghada Marriott is located directly on the beach and boasts views of the Red Sea from each of the 283 rooms and suites. The hotel has a choice of nine different restaurants and bars, including the finest Italian cuisine in Hurghada, an Asian restaurant, and a poolside barbeque and bar. Those seeking more dining and nightlife options should head to Marina Hurghada Boulevard, which is just a ten minute drive away.
